How much does it cost to rent a home in Grapevine?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Grapevine 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,553 | $1,350 | $8,850 |
Grapevine 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,145 | $2,100 | $5,000 |
Grapevine 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$4,641 | $2,000 | $10,000+ |
Grapevine 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$5,871 | $2,600 | $9,995 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Grapevine
What type of rentals are currently available in Grapevine?
There are currently 114 Apartments for Rent in Grapevine, TX with pricing that ranges from $824 to $21,575. There are also 101 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Grapevine ranging from $650 to $16,500.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Grapevine?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Grapevine ranges from $650 to $16,500 with an average monthly rent of $3,557.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Grapevine?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Grapevine range from $1,561 to $21,575,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$2,100 to $5,000.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$2,000 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$2,995.
